                         It will be noticed that whilst less coffee was imported during 1370, than in 1369, the value is
                    higher, thus illustrating the rising cost of commodities.

                         A study of the above figures will show that not only food-stuffs but piece-goods also
                     have advanced in price over the previous year.

                          The increase in the number of Native Craft calling at Bahrain during the year under review
                     was due to the increased imports of live-stock during the months of Shaban and Ramadhan, because
                     of increased supplies of barter sugar given during those two months,
